Worth grading — even a PSA 9 beats raw

A PSA 10 Donald Duck [Refractor] #86 sells for $274 against $28.31 raw: a $245 spread, 9.7× the ungraded price. Even a PSA 9 ($75.00) clears the raw price after an economy-tier ~$25 fee, so a near-miss still comes out ahead. Centering is the usual reason a clean copy misses the 10 — measure it before you submit.

Which grading company is best for Donald Duck [Refractor] #86?

By resale value, BGS 10 leads at $356, ahead of PSA 10 at $274. Fees and turnaround differ, so the best-paying label is not always the best net.

What centering does Donald Duck [Refractor] #86 need for a BGS 10?

BGS publishes 55/45 front and 70/30 back centering as the tolerance for a 10 (Gem Mint). Off-center copies are capped below the top grade regardless of surface — measure yours before paying the fee.
